How can we come together in shared human presence in an ever-complexing world?

This is one of the crucial questions of our time. The overabundance of information, polarizing perspectives and the acceleration of change show the limitations of bureaucratic decision-making and individual expert knowledge. Openness and alertness to Interbeing, the field of aliveness that always connects us, and an emergent dialogue offer us new key skills for the 21st.century.

Emergent Dialogue is a cultural practice for a new, trans-individual culture. Our one-sided “I”-focused civilization today threatens our entire biosphere. We need new forms of collective intelligence in which our interconnectedness with all life on earth can be directly experienced. Emergent Interbeing and dialogues which grow from there are one way of practicing this new, integral we-culture.

In the space of ever-present connectedness that we call Emergent Interbeing, we can experience that we as human beings are not separate from each other, from the living world, and from the cosmos.
 
When we bring our uniqueness into this shared presence, unprecedented forms of shared knowing, sensing, thinking, caring, and creating emerge - a holistic force for our common human project on Earth.
 
Emergent Dialogue is a practical application of Emergent Interbeing. By cultivating the ever-present interconnectedness of all living beings and awareness of the interpersonal process, this new approach to dialogue allows us to work with a synergistic intelligence in which conflict potentials are transformed into creative tension that opens spaces for a co-creative future.
 
The emergence of human possibilities that occurs between us in the open center can transform us and inspire a conscious, regenerative culture of togetherness.

Marlene Potthoff studied biology and political science and has been working in the environmental movement for over 20 years. In addition to her commitment to climate protection and the development of environmental awareness, it has always been important for her to recognize and gain a deeper understanding of the spiritual impulse within herself. Through her intensive engagement with these two interests – the need for social commitment and the perception of the importance of the spiritual dimension – she discovered the significance of the evolutionary development of consciousness in us humans. She sees emergent dialogue as an ideal combination of these two impulses for the development of a new human culture. She runs the Emergent Interbeing programs and the emergent dialogue offerings on a voluntary basis.
